About this work

This painting shows a quiet path winding through tall trees by a river at dusk. A lone figure walks ahead, leading a donkey loaded with bundles, while another person follows behind. The sky is darkening, and the landscape stretches into rolling hills in the distance. The artist paid close attention to how light fades in the trees, making shadows soft and deep.
